Transaction e8b44ba9eb9873095608ccffff8ca0930599fee320d585f103539f9fcc6c895d
1 Input
1 Output
-
e8b44ba9eb9873095608ccffff8ca0930599fee320d585f103539f9fcc6c895d:0
- value
- 1738201
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1097bbeebf57b7b25d1236488195c779f6b72c22 OP_EQUAL
- address
- 33CkWHRTjWGY2Es9TAH83tcrhce3zW5Vyq